I have a transverse tree written in JSP which goes through an XML file.

When I get to a certain Text Node, I’d like to be able to search back up the tree to find a certain element associated with that node.

I’m thinking I need to do a For loop and use some kind of ‘getLastNode’ or ‘getParentNode’ function. Would this be the correct method? I’m a little unsure of the syntax, so any help would be much appreciated!

I did a bit of search and I can’t find anything which demonstrates what I’m trying to do nor can I find a list of the functions I’m after.

    You need to keep calling getParentNode until you hit a node matching your criteria. For example:

    public Node searchUpFor(String tagToFind, Node aNode) {
        Node n = aNode.getParentNode();
        while (n != null && !n.getNodeName().equals(tagToFind)) {
            n = n.getParentNode();
        }
        return n;
    }
